Setting up your workspace

When you're working from your desk on a regular basis, it's important that you find a good place to work. Find a quiet place with a good internet connection, access to power sources, and free from any unecessary distractions. 

You should try to make sure that your workspace has sufficient light, ventilation and no trailing cords so that you are working in the most comfortable environment possible. It is also important to stay hydrated, have a supply of healthy snacks and ensure that you are taking regular breaks to maintain your focus.
